Hidden costs of water damage on a small team

A plumbing emergency is not just “water on the floor”. For a startup, it often ends up as a cascade of minor failures.

You might face:

  • Direct hardware loss like laptops, monitors, routers, switches, VR gear, IoT prototypes, lab equipment.
  • Network disruption if your modem, gateway or internal wiring is affected.
  • Health and safety risks, so your landlord or property manager locks the office until inspection.
  • Mold and air quality problems if water sits unnoticed in walls or carpets.
  • Data access issues if you run any local test databases or internal tools on machines in the office.

The hardware is easy to price. The lost time is harder.

Let me put some rough numbers on it. You can adjust them for your own context.

Impact Area Example Scenario Approx Cost for a 10-person Startup
Lost workday Office is closed for cleanup 10 people x $60/hour x 8 hours = $4,800 in labor time
Hardware damage 4 laptops and 4 monitors ruined under a leak $1,000–$1,500 per laptop, $250 per monitor = around $6,000–$8,000
Client trust Missed demo or delayed rollout Impossible to price cleanly, but could mean a lost contract
Temporary workspace Short-term coworking passes or hotel meeting room $400–$1,000 depending on how many days
Insurance deductible Claim for water damage $500–$2,500 depending on your policy

This is not a “what if the building floods” scenario. This is from one broken pipe in a wall that no one checked until it was too late.

Plumbing problems do not need to be huge to be expensive. They just need to hit you on the wrong week.

A reliable emergency plumber shrinks every row in that table. Faster response usually means less water, less damage, less downtime, less drama.

The silent enemy: condensation and humidity

Hardware does not like water. That is obvious. What people often miss is that humidity around hardware can cause problems even without a visible leak.

In poorly ventilated rooms, a slow pipe leak behind a wall can raise moisture levels enough to:

  • Shorten the life of network switches or routers.
  • Corrode contacts on test rigs or dev boards.
  • Warp wooden furniture that supports monitors and gear.

If you keep any servers, NAS devices or sensitive electronics in a small closet, ask your emergency plumber to inspect pipes along that path once a year. A quick look is cheap and might catch condensation, flaking, or minor leaks you would never see.

Practical steps: turning “we should” into “we did”

Saying “we should have an emergency plumber” is easy. Making it real takes maybe one afternoon, and then it is done. Many teams just never block the time.

Here is a simple process you can follow with your cofounder or operations lead.

1. Map your actual physical risk

Walk through your space and ask a few blunt questions:

  • Where are the restrooms, kitchen, water heaters and any exposed pipes?
  • Is there a unit above or below you that has water usage like bathrooms, laundry, or a cafe?
  • Where is your hardware, especially any irreplaceable prototypes or network gear?
  • Do you know where the main water shutoff is for your suite or floor?

You might feel a bit silly doing this as a software founder. Do it anyway. You will likely learn something about your building that the lease never covered.

2. Talk to your landlord or property manager first

This is an easy step to miss.

Ask them:

  • Who do you usually call for plumbing emergencies?
  • Is there a preferred vendor list we need to follow?
  • What counts as “my responsibility” vs “building responsibility” if a pipe breaks?

Sometimes they already have an emergency plumber on contract. If you like that provider, problem solved. If you do not, you can still have your own choice ready for situations that clearly fall under your space, not shared lines.

3. Choose and “onboard” your plumber

Treat this a bit like hiring a vendor.

You do not need long calls. You do need clarity.

Look for:

  • Clear, simple pricing for emergency calls.
  • Availability in Eagle Mountain at odd hours.
  • Some history with commercial or mixed-use clients.

Once you pick one, do not stop there.

Add them to:

  • Your office emergency contact sheet, posted near entrances and in your wiki or Notion.
  • A shared phone contact group for founders and leads.
  • Any incident or “what if” checklist you keep for operational risks.

If you want to go one step further, schedule a non-emergency visit. Have them walk the space, point out shutoff valves, and note any concerns. That visit is often quick and may save confusion later when the pressure is high.

4. Run a quick tabletop exercise

This might sound very corporate, but you can do it in 15 minutes.

Gather your leadership crew and run a simple imaginary scenario:

“Pipe bursts in the kitchen at 9 p.m. on a Sunday. Water is spreading onto the floor.”

Ask:

  • Who gets the first call?
  • Who calls the plumber?
  • Who calls the landlord?
  • Who has keys and alarm codes?
  • Who decides to shut off power in certain rooms?

You will probably find at least one gap, like “only one person knows where the electrical panel is” or “no one has the landlord number saved anywhere except that one email from two years ago”.

Fix those gaps while you are calm. It is exactly like fire drills, but for pipes.

Insurance, contracts and the boring paperwork that saves you

Technical founders often push boring paperwork to the bottom of the list. Fair enough. But plumbing events sit right in the area where insurance, leasing and vendor contracts matter.

A bit of reading now can dodge big arguments later.

Know what your insurance actually covers

Many office or business policies cover water damage, but with conditions:

  • Some types of leaks or slow damage might be excluded.
  • There is usually a deductible that hits your cash directly.
  • Damage from tenant-installed fixtures might be treated differently.

It is worth asking your broker one simple question: “If a pipe breaks above our office, what would you cover, and what evidence would you want from us?”

Then, during a real incident, make sure your emergency plumber helps you document the problem. Clear notes on what failed, where it came from, and what was done matter for claims.

Leases and responsibility splits

Leases often split responsibilities roughly like this:

  • You handle fixtures and plumbing inside your space that you control.
  • The landlord handles shared or structural plumbing like main risers and common areas.

There are exceptions, and your lease likely explains them in clauses that nobody enjoys reading.

If you understand that split before anything goes wrong, you can:

  • Call the right person faster.
  • Know when to bring your own plumber in without fear of footing the whole building’s bill.
  • Push back or discuss costs more confidently after the fact.

An emergency plumber used to commercial work will also usually know how to phrase their reports so landlords and insurers understand what happened.

Simple checklist you can steal today

To make this less theoretical, here is a short checklist you can drop into your internal wiki or Slack and work through over a week.

Basic startup plumbing risk checklist

  • Walk the space: list restrooms, kitchen, water heaters, visible pipes, and any area that feels damp or smells musty.
  • Find the main water shutoff or ask your landlord where it is.
  • Ask landlord/property manager who handles plumbing emergencies and what number they call.
  • Confirm what your lease says about internal vs building plumbing repairs.
  • Pick one emergency plumber you trust in Eagle Mountain, based on response time and commercial experience.
  • Add their number to a printed emergency contact sheet and to a shared digital doc.
  • Save that contact in at least 3 team phones: founder, ops/office lead, head of engineering.
  • Move any irreplaceable hardware off the floor and away from obvious water paths.
  • Place surge protectors and power strips higher, not on the floor where water will run first.
  • Run a 15 minute discussion: “If a pipe breaks tonight, who does what?”

If you do those ten things, you are already far ahead of many teams that never think about this until they smell wet carpet on a Monday morning.
